Analysis
The most recent figure for out-of-school adolescents of lower secondary school age, both sexes in Iceland is 24 number, measured in 2018.
That represents a change of down 60.7% on the previous year and down 94.7% over ten years.
Over the whole period, out-of-school adolescents of lower secondary school age, both sexes in Iceland peaked at 1,094 number in 2000 and was at its lowest, 14 number, in 2005.
Iceland ranks 149th of 150 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Out-of-school adolescents of lower secondary school age, both sexes in Iceland, year by year
| Year | number |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 1998 | 273 number | — |
| 1999 | 880 number | +222.3% |
| 2000 | 1,094 number | +24.3% |
| 2001 | 755 number | -31.0% |
| 2002 | 250 number | -66.9% |
| 2005 | 14 number | -94.4% |
| 2006 | 134 number | +857.1% |
| 2007 | 358 number | +167.2% |
| 2008 | 451 number | +26.0% |
| 2009 | 597 number | +32.4% |
| 2010 | 579 number | -3.0% |
| 2011 | 447 number | -22.8% |
| 2012 | 268 number | -40.0% |
| 2013 | 222 number | -17.2% |
| 2014 | 90 number | -59.5% |
| 2015 | 67 number | -25.6% |
| 2016 | 18 number | -73.1% |
| 2017 | 61 number | +238.9% |
| 2018 | 24 number | -60.7% |
